Why Cycling Your Caffeine Intake Might Be Your New Productivity Secret Weapon

Caffeine is the most widely consumed psychoactive substance in the world, often serving as the primary fuel source for digital nomads and tech enthusiasts working across various time zones. While that morning cup of coffee provides an immediate neurochemical spark, many professionals fall into the trap of escalating consumption to maintain the same level of alertness. This cycle of dependency leads to a phenomenon known as caffeine tolerance, where the brain upregulates adenosine receptors to compensate for the constant presence of stimulants. To maintain a high productivity baseline without the inevitable crash, high-performers are increasingly turning to caffeine cycling as a sustainable alternative. This strategy involves intentional periods of consumption followed by scheduled breaks to reset the body's sensitivity.
